[Wien] Compiling problem

Peter Blaha pblaha at zeus.theochem.tuwien.ac.at
Sat Apr 2 20:15:23 CEST 2005


You need to install  Scalapack (or  you need to specify the 
scalapack libraries) when you want to use the mpi parallel version.

However, when you have just one dual Opteron system, I would not go for 
the mpi Version, because it will not help you much, neither with memory 
nor with speed-improvements. You need more than 2 processors to gain.

> I'm having a problem when trying to install Wien2k on a Fedora 
1 > x86_64 under Dual processors AMD Opteron  system with pathscale
> compiler (pathf90, pathfcc, mpif90).
> 
> Here's my siteconfig file:
> current:FOPT:-O -freeform
> current:FPOPT:-O -freeform
> current:LDFLAGS:-L../SRC_lib
> current:DPARALLEL:'-DParallel'
> current:R_LIBS:-llapack_lapw -lblas_lapw -llapack_lapw -lblas_lapw
> current:RP_LIBS:-L/usr/local/lib -L/usr/local/mpich_pathscale/lib -lmpich
> current:MPIRUN:mpirun -np _NP_ -machinefile _HOSTS_ _EXEC_
> 
> I got a list of errors, pls help:
> 
> wfpnt.o(.text+0xfa): In function `wfpnt_':
> : undefined reference to `pzgemr2d_'
> wfpnt1.o(.text+0x130): In function `wfpnt1_':
> : undefined reference to `pzgemr2d_'
> pdsyr2m.o(.text+0x165): In function `pdsyr2m_':
> : undefined reference to `blacs_gridinfo__'
> pdsyr2m.o(.text+0x33f): In function `pdsyr2m_':
> : undefined reference to `pdsyr2k_'
> pdsyr2m.o(.text+0x438): In function `pdsyr2m_':
> : undefined reference to `pdgemm_'
> pdsyr2m.o(.text+0x659): In function `pdsyr2m_':
> : undefined reference to `pdsyr2k_'
> pdsyr2m.o(.text+0x752): In function `pdsyr2m_':
> : undefined reference to `pdgemm_'
> pzher2m.o(.text+0x23a): In function `pzher2m_':
> : undefined reference to `blacs_gridinfo__'
> pzher2m.o(.text+0x3de): In function `pzher2m_':
> : undefined reference to `pzgemm_'
> pzher2m.o(.text+0x5b7): In function `pzher2m_':
> : undefined reference to `pzgemm_'
> pzher2m.o(.text+0x786): In function `pzher2m_':
> : undefined reference to `pzher2k_'
> pzher2m.o(.text+0x886): In function `pzher2m_':
> : undefined reference to `pzgemm_'
> pzher2m.o(.text+0xa2f): In function `pzher2m_':
> : undefined reference to `pzsyr2k_'
> pzher2m.o(.text+0xbeb): In function `pzher2m_':
> : undefined reference to `pzher2k_'
> pzher2m.o(.text+0xce3): In function `pzher2m_':
> : undefined reference to `pzgemm_'
> pzher2m.o(.text+0xe8a): In function `pzher2m_':
> : undefined reference to `pzsyr2k_'
> collect2: ld returned 1 exit status
> make[1]: *** [lapw1c_mpi] Error 1
> 
> 
> Regards,
> James
> HPC
> Email: hpc.group at gmail.com
> 
> _______________________________________________
> Wien mailing list
> Wien at zeus.theochem.tuwien.ac.at
> http://zeus.theochem.tuwien.ac.at/mailman/listinfo/wien
> 


                                      P.Blaha
--------------------------------------------------------------------------
Peter BLAHA, Inst.f. Materials Chemistry, TU Vienna, A-1060 Vienna
Phone: +43-1-58801-15671             FAX: +43-1-58801-15698
Email: blaha at theochem.tuwien.ac.at    WWW: http://info.tuwien.ac.at/theochem/
--------------------------------------------------------------------------




More information about the Wien mailing list